| Omitir Vínculos de navegación | |
| Salir de la Vista de impresión | |
|
Interfaz de programación de aplicaciones de RESTful de Oracle® ZFS Storage Appliance |
Capítulo 1 Descripción general
Capítulo 3 Comandos del servicio de alertas
Capítulo 4 Servicios de análisis
Capítulo 5 Servicios de hardware
Capítulo 8 Comandos del servicio de problemas
Capítulo 11 Comandos de servicio
Capítulo 12 Servicios de almacenamiento
Capítulo 13 Comandos del sistema
Capítulo 14 Servicio del usuario
Capítulo 15 Comandos de flujo de trabajo
Carga un flujo de trabajo al dispositivo.
Ejemplo de solicitud:
POST /api/workflow/v1/workflows HTTP/1.1
Authorization: Basic abcefgMWE=
Host: zfssa.example.com:215
Accept: application/json
Content-Type: application/javascript
Content-Length: 290
var workflow = {
name: 'Echo',
description: 'Echo bird repeats a song.',
parameters: {
song: {
label: 'Words of a song to sing',
type: 'String',
}
},
execute: function (params) { return (params.song) }
};
Resultado de ejemplo:
HTTP/1.1 201 Created
X-Zfssa-Appliance-Api: 1.0
Content-Type: application/json
Content-Length: 268
X-Zfssa-Version: jkremer/generic@2013.09.14,1-0
Location: /api/workflow/v1/workflows/f4fe892f-cf46-4d6a-9026-cd0c0cce9971
{
"workflow": {
"href": "/api/workflow/v1/workflows/f4fe892f-cf46-4d6a-9026-cd0c0cce9971",
"name": "Echo",
"description": "Echo bird repeats a song.",
"uuid": "f4fe892f-cf46-4d6a-9026-cd0c0cce9971",
"owner": "root",
"origin": "<local>",
"setid": false,
"alert": false,
"version": "",
"scheduled": false
}
}